Huntsville MidCity District Secures Dollar : Huntsville’s MidCity District is set to receive a substantial financial boost of over $20 million through an investment from Benson Capital Partners (BCP), a New Orleans-based venture capital group. Founded in 2019 by Gayle Benson, owner of the New Orleans Saints and governor of the New Orleans Pelicans, BCP specializes in investments across various sectors, including tourism, logistics, health care, and energy.

BCP’s investment, totaling more than $5 million, demonstrates the firm’s commitment to supporting transformative projects, aligning with RCP Companies’ vision for the MidCity District. Keith Schneider, Managing Director for Benson Capital’s real estate fund, expressed excitement about contributing to the redefinition of community spaces within the MidCity District.

In addition to the investment, Randy Wolfe, Senior Vice President and Managing Director at Northmarq, facilitated a $13.75 million loan for MidCity Placemakers Retail II. This retail space spans 82,669 square feet within the MidCity District and is part of the larger development near Cummings Research Park and Redstone Arsenal.

The MidCity District, a burgeoning area, is strategically located and expected to feature 1,865 residential units, 925 hotel keys, office spaces, and outdoor gathering spaces. The recent financial infusion, along with the long-term loan provided by Northmarq, positions MidCity for remarkable growth and underscores the commitment of RCP Companies to creating thriving environments.

The partnership between Benson Capital Partners and MidCity developer RCP Companies signals a bright future for the MidCity District and highlights the potential for transformative development in the Huntsville community.
